General Info
In Block
997b0b19cca0bc28557b7925a6070c616b6bee142c2686ba2e3b9296f854740a
In block height
Total Input
2580693.68208392 RDD
Total Output
2580741.6331127 RDD
Transaction Details
Fee
0 RDD
mined Sat, 03 Jun 2017 22:56:45 UTC
From
2580693.68208392 RDD